The Toy Association’s annual Toy Safety & Legislative Update will take place Monday, February 16 at Toy Fair® in New York City. Registered Toy Fair attendees receive complimentary access to this must-attend seminar, taking place from 8:30 to 11 a.m. in the General Session Theatre (Hall 1D). Complimentary breakfast, sponsored by SGS North America, will be served to seminar attendees beginning at 8 a.m.
The session will include insights from Toy Association leadership and safety and regulatory experts, who will share the toy industry’s top state, federal, and international legislative and regulatory priorities, including key product safety-related activity and an update on the Association’s ongoing advocacy against tariffs on toys. Representatives from Health Canada will address changes to the Canadian Consumer Product Safety Act, and additional topics will include a forecast of the top legislative issues anticipated within U.S. states in 2026, new toy safety requirements under the European Toy Safety Regulation, and more.
